The Gap of Dunloe is a study in contrast. The start of the walk is in the midst of dark, imposing mountains. Almost black. And, once through the gap, the scenery changes dramatically. I took this shot facing backwards on the trail. The black mountains are gone. But the new mountains were shrouded in cloud.
